Output e2b8668d2c03c7ab33faa11532d8ddad847e85c9b3e42e7d4dbadb77ed89b98e:0

value
25159930057
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6de5067604051321e19cd4506894d545e7b1896c OP_EQUALVERIFY OP_CHECKSIG
address
DFAAZ7wZRvxSscMdDMdvP6tRZfq1CzFej5
transaction
e2b8668d2c03c7ab33faa11532d8ddad847e85c9b3e42e7d4dbadb77ed89b98e